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omQuiet location 15 minutes from Wells next the sea beach. Parking onsite. Spaceous accommodation that allowed us to relax in the evening after busy days at the beach. High ceilings and velux windows make the upstairs living are feel very spacious. Handy to have a washing machine. A local farm shop, corner shop and Nortons cafe were close for eating out. The Black Lion pub is closed on Wednesday and Thursday, so The Bull pub is only a short walk. We loved catching the train from Walsingham to Wells. Its 1hr 15 roundtrip.

Superb location, right in the heart of Walsingham, and next door to a lovely pub with very good food (book in advance, I recommend the scallops). The property layout is really cool - bedrooms downstairs and an open plan kitchen/dining/living room upstairs, which is unusual and fun (the kids loved going downstairs to bed). A cute little garden seating area outside with table and chairs too - it was too hot to eat outside the days we were there but normally that would be a great sun trap and very comfortable to have breakfast or lunch outside. Only 300 yards to Walsingham Village Stores and round the corner is an excellent little coffee shop that has local icecream. Just 5 mins walk away is the Walsingham Farm Shop - top notch butcher counter with prepared pies as well as local meat. A huge added bonus for the property is the parking space as it’s hard to park in Walsingham.
